Mental Health in Bridgton, ME - What is Mental Health
The definition of mental health is the condition of our emotional, cognitive, and behavioral well-being. Simply put: It’s the state of our minds. It can affect everything from our thoughts and feelings, to how we act and how our bodies respond to certain situations and stimuli.
Our mental health can have a significant impact on our overall quality of life. Our relationships, careers, and finances can all suffer. It impacts our self-esteem, influences how we make choices, how we communicate, and even our learning capabilities.
Although it may be a part of our wellbeing that we can’t actually touch, our mental well-being determines how we interact with the world around us. Ultimately, it makes up the very fabric of who we are.
Types of Mental Health Providers in Bridgton, ME
No two people with mental illness experience it in the exact same way. As such, there are multiple types of mental health professionals that use different techniques and serve distinct roles.
Psychologists in Bridgton
Psychologists are trained and educated to conduct psychological evaluations and provide diagnoses. During a therapy session with a psychiatrist, you can expect to work on identifying harmful thoughts and emotions and developing coping mechanisms to manage them. Much of their practice zeros in on addressing and resolving destructive and otherwise unhealthy behaviors.
Psychiatrists in Bridgton
Sometimes an individual needs more immediate or intense treatment compared to what a psychologist can offer - namely prescription medication. Psychiatrists are physicians (medical doctors) who specialize in mental illness and therefore can offer prescription medication. Although they are trained and qualified to conduct psychotherapy (talk therapy), not all psychiatrists do.
Therapists, Counselors & Clinicians in Bridgton
All are interchangeable terms used to describe mental health care professionals with a masters-level education in in a field related to mental or public health. As they are not medical doctors, they tend to treat mental health issues with approaches similar to psychologists. More often than not, talk therapy is the primary treatment approach.
Paying for Bridgton Mental Health Rehab
Everything costs something - including mental healthcare The cost of housing, medication, therapy, and all other aspects of recovery can add up. Someone has to pay them. In the United States, the most common method of paying for any type of health care is insurance. However, this isn’t the only option. Here is an overview of all of the ways to pay for mental healthcare:
- Private Insurance might be offered through your employer or your spouse/parent’s employer. You can also sign up for your own private insurance plan directly through a private insurance provider.
- Subsidized Private Insurance is available through an online marketplace to individuals who have an income below a certain threshold, yet are not eligible for medicare/medicaid.
- Medicare - A government-funded healthcare option available to individuals over the age of 65.
- Medicaid - A government-funded healthcare option available to low-income individuals and families.Medicare/Medicaid- Government-funded healthcare options for those below a certain income or over the age of 65.
- Cash Pay] - Those who have the financial means may pay for their mental health therapy Bridgton out-of-pocket. People who can self-pay - but not all at once - may ask about a payment plan or line of credit.
- Scholarships - Some mental health rehabilitation facilities Bridgton offer a scholarship for people who exhibit a great yearning and dedication to healing, but do not have the financial means] to pay for [the treatment they need.
- “Free” Programs - Certain organizations use the funds to provide mental health services to their local community. However, there may be a long waiting period in areas with a greater need for these services.
